    Run the correct command for your package manager:

    • NPM: npm install @folderharbor/sdk
    • Yarn: yarn add @folderharbor/sdk
    • PNPM: pnpm add @folderharbor/sdk
    • Bun: bun install @folderharbor/sdk

    To use this SDK in your own code, you need a running FolderHarbor Server.
    (if you're just playing around, you can use the official demo, https://demo.fh.novatea.dev)

    Once you have one, you can follow either of these starting structures!

    const client = new FolderHarbor({ server: "[your server address]" }); // set up the client
    await client.auth.login({ username: "[your username]", password: "[your password]" }); // log in
    // and you're ready to make calls! :3c

    This is if you already have a token for the FolderHarbor server, say if you are making a CLI tool and have the user's token stored on-device.

    const client = new FolderHarbor({ server: "[your server address]", token: "[your token]" }); // set up and authenticate
    // and you're ready to make calls!

    I heavily suggest reading the example and documentation attached to each method before using it! You can see these with your code editor's IntelliSense, or in the documentation.

    The SDK version should always remain 1:1 with the version of FolderHarbor Server that it is intended to interact with. However, if I need to push urgent SDK changes without updating the server, I will update the patch version (the last number). In other words, v1.1.1 SDK is still compatible with v1.1.0 server, but v1.1.1 SDK may not be compatible with v1.2.0 server (or vice versa). I will communicate this if I do it, in the CHANGELOG.md and/or on https://fh.novatea.dev.
